lunacm hsm Commands
This command, and all the lunacm hsm commands, appear only when the current slot selected in lunacm is for a local HSM, like an installed Luna PCI-E.
HSM commands do not appear in the lunacm command menu when lunacm is directed at a slot corresponding to a remote Luna SA - lunacm has a client-only connection to a remote HSM and therefore cannot log in as SO to a remote HSM.
For Luna SA, the HSM commands are available via the Luna appliance's Luna Shell (lunash:>), which can be accessed via ssh if you have the required authentication.
NAME
hsm rollbackFW - Rollback the HSM Firmware
SYNOPSIS
lunacm:> hsm rollbackFW
DESCRIPTION
Performs a firmware rollbackTo return the HSM to its previous firmware version. This gives up any enhancements or fixes that were gained by the newer firmware version, as well as any upgrades that were installed after the firmware update (that is to be rolled back). on the Luna HSM, to the immediately previous installed version. Only that one firmware version is available for rollback.
The HSM must be re-initialized after firmware rollback, before it can be used again - therefore, back up any important materials before you run this command.
Rollback allows you to try a new firmware version (hsm updateFW command) without permanently committing to the new version.

SAMPLE OUTPUT
lunacm:> hsm login
Please attend to the PED.
Command Result : No Error
lunacm:> hsm rollbackFW
You are about to rollback the firmware.
The HSM will be reset.
Are you sure you wish to continue?
Type 'proceed' to continue, or 'quit' to quit now -> proceed
Rolling back firmware. This may take several minutes.
Firmware rollback passed. Resetting HSM
Command Result : No Error
lunacm:>
